[Wayland] PWAs no longer appear as separate app windows — all group under main Edge icon
Hi, Since around 2025-09-07 to 2025-09-10, I’ve noticed that on GNOME (Wayland) all installed PWAs (even across different profiles) now appear grouped under the main Edge browser icon in the GNOME Shell dash/taskbar. Previously, each PWA would open in its own window group with its own icon. This is still the behavior in Chromium/Brave/Chrome, and can be restored there by editing the PWA’s .desktop file to set: StartupWMClass=<same value as Icon> However, Edge now seems to ignore StartupWMClass completely on Wayland, breaking workspace separation and making task switching hard. Environment: Ubuntu 25.04 GNOME 48.0 / Mutter (Wayland) Kernel 6.14.0-29 Intel Iris Xe GPU Edge (latest stable, observed post 2025-09-13) Repro steps: Install any PWA (e.g. Outlook, Teams, Spotify) from Edge Launch it (from any profile) Observe that it appears grouped under the main Edge browser icon Expected: PWA shows under its own icon and window group like in Chromium-based browsers Actual: All PWAs are bundled into the main Edge window group Editing StartupWMClass in the .desktop file no longer helps This regression makes PWAs much harder to manage on Wayland. Hello. I have an issue with my MSI GE75 laptop running Windows 11 with an RTX 2070. When I use a second monitor Dell connected via HDMI, content inside Microsoft Edge and Google Chrome starts flickering and lagging. Firefox works fine on the same setup. The laptop is MSI GE75 with RTX 2070 and Intel iGPU. The second monitor is a Dell. Browsers affected are Edge and Chrome. Browser not affected is Firefox. I set Edge and Chrome to run on the RTX 2070 in Windows graphics settings. All drivers are updated. All settings are on maximum. The issue is flickering and micro freezes while scrolling or playing videos on the second monitor. This does not happen on the main laptop display. I already tried switching Edge and Chrome to High performance GPU RTX 2070 in Windows settings with no effect. I updated NVIDIA and Intel drivers with no effect. I disabled hardware acceleration in Edge and Chrome which reduces the issue but performance drops. I set both monitors to the same refresh rate 60 Hz but the problem persists. Since the problem only happens with Chromium based browsers and only on the second monitor, I suspect it could be related to how Microsoft rendering pipeline interacts with Chromium hardware acceleration. Firefox which uses a different rendering backend works fine. My questions are: Why does this only happen with Chromium based browsers but not Firefox? Is this related to how Windows and Chromium handle GPU acceleration on a second monitor? Is there a known fix or workaround to make Edge and Chrome work properly on the second monitor?
